You might want to test nested classes of class templates.  I don't know if we 
encode nested classes in any reasonable way in the first place.

I'm generally okay with being aggressive about stripping this kind of 
information from encodings, since encodings are not good enough to do type 
reflection in ObjC++ anyway.  If you did decide you wanted to preserve more 
information from the encoding, though, you could consider only applying this at 
the innermost level that mentions a template specialization type, rather than 
the outermost.  That is, the new logic seems to not expand the `X` in `X*` if 
`X` recursively has a field that's a pointer to a template specialization, 
rather than expanding `X` and then not expanding the type of that one field.  
Definitely not something I think you need to do now, though.
